/external/chromium_org/third_party/libvpx/source/libvpx/vp8/encoder/arm/neon/ |
subtract_neon.c | 67 uint8x16_t q0u8, q1u8, q2u8, q3u8; local 75 q1u8 = vld1q_u8(pred); 80 q8u16 = vsubl_u8(vget_low_u8(q0u8), vget_low_u8(q1u8)); 81 q9u16 = vsubl_u8(vget_high_u8(q0u8), vget_high_u8(q1u8));
|
vp8_mse16x16_neon.c | 22 uint8x16_t q0u8, q1u8, q2u8, q3u8; local 35 q1u8 = vld1q_u8(src_ptr); 44 q13u16 = vsubl_u8(vget_low_u8(q1u8), vget_low_u8(q3u8)); 45 q14u16 = vsubl_u8(vget_high_u8(q1u8), vget_high_u8(q3u8));
|
/external/chromium_org/third_party/libvpx/source/libvpx/vp8/common/arm/neon/ |
bilinearpredict_neon.c | 33 uint8x16_t q1u8, q2u8; local 64 q1u8 = vcombine_u8(d2u8, d3u8); 70 q4u64 = vshrq_n_u64(vreinterpretq_u64_u8(q1u8), 8); 74 d0u32x2 = vzip_u32(vreinterpret_u32_u8(vget_low_u8(q1u8)), 75 vreinterpret_u32_u8(vget_high_u8(q1u8))); 141 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8; local 152 q1u8 = vld1q_u8(src_ptr); src_ptr += src_pixels_per_line; 161 q6u16 = vmull_u8(vget_low_u8(q1u8), d0u8); 167 d3u8 = vext_u8(vget_low_u8(q1u8), vget_high_u8(q1u8), 1) 228 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8; local 369 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8, q6u8, q7u8, q8u8, q9u8, q10u8; local [all...] |
variance_neon.c | 24 uint8x16_t q0u8, q1u8, q2u8, q3u8; local 36 q1u8 = vld1q_u8(src_ptr); 48 q13u16 = vsubl_u8(vget_low_u8(q1u8), vget_low_u8(q3u8)); 49 q14u16 = vsubl_u8(vget_high_u8(q1u8), vget_high_u8(q3u8)); 103 uint8x16_t q0u8, q1u8, q2u8, q3u8; local 115 q1u8 = vld1q_u8(src_ptr); 127 q13u16 = vsubl_u8(vget_low_u8(q1u8), vget_low_u8(q3u8)); 128 q14u16 = vsubl_u8(vget_high_u8(q1u8), vget_high_u8(q3u8));
|
vp8_subpixelvariance_neon.c | 44 uint8x16_t q0u8, q1u8, q2u8, q3u8, q4u8, q5u8, q6u8, q7u8, q8u8, q9u8; local 100 q1u8 = vcombine_u8(d2u8, d3u8); 107 vst1q_u8((uint8_t *)tmpp2, q1u8); 405 q1u8 = vcombine_u8(d2u8, d3u8); 412 vst1q_u8((uint8_t *)tmpp2, q1u8); 432 q1u8 = vld1q_u8(tmpp); 441 d2u8 = vget_low_u8(q1u8); 442 d3u8 = vget_high_u8(q1u8); 507 uint8x16_t q0u8, q1u8, q2u8, q3u8, q4u8, q5u8, q6u8; local 519 q1u8 = vld1q_u8(src_ptr + 16) 643 uint8x16_t q0u8, q1u8, q2u8, q3u8, q4u8, q5u8, q6u8, q7u8, q15u8; local 773 uint8x16_t q0u8, q1u8, q2u8, q3u8, q4u8, q5u8, q6u8, q7u8, q8u8, q9u8; local [all...] |
mbloopfilter_neon.c | 32 uint8x16_t q0u8, q1u8, q11u8, q12u8, q13u8, q14u8, q15u8; local 43 q1u8 = vabdq_u8(q9, q8); 48 q1u8 = vmaxq_u8(q1u8, q0u8); 56 q15u8 = vmaxq_u8(q15u8, q1u8); 60 q1u8 = vabdq_u8(q5, q8); 73 q1u8 = vshrq_n_u8(q1u8, 1); 74 q12u8 = vqaddq_u8(q12u8, q1u8); 145 q1u8 = vdupq_n_u8(0x80) [all...] |
loopfilter_neon.c | 30 uint8x16_t q0u8, q1u8, q2u8, q11u8, q12u8, q13u8, q14u8, q15u8; local 89 q1u8 = vandq_u8(vreinterpretq_u8_s8(q1s8), q14u8); 92 q1s8 = vreinterpretq_s8_u8(q1u8); 101 q1u8 = vandq_u8(vreinterpretq_u8_s8(q1s8), q15u8); 102 q1s8 = vreinterpretq_s8_u8(q1u8);
|
/external/libvpx/libvpx/vp8/common/arm/neon/ |
bilinearpredict_neon.c | 34 uint8x16_t q1u8, q2u8; local 61 q1u8 = vcombine_u8(d2u8, d3u8); 67 q4u64 = vshrq_n_u64(vreinterpretq_u64_u8(q1u8), 8); 71 d0u32x2 = vzip_u32(vreinterpret_u32_u8(vget_low_u8(q1u8)), 72 vreinterpret_u32_u8(vget_high_u8(q1u8))); 138 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8; local 149 q1u8 = vld1q_u8(src_ptr); src_ptr += src_pixels_per_line; 158 q6u16 = vmull_u8(vget_low_u8(q1u8), d0u8); 164 d3u8 = vext_u8(vget_low_u8(q1u8), vget_high_u8(q1u8), 1) 225 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8; local 366 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8, q6u8, q7u8, q8u8, q9u8, q10u8; local [all...] |
/hardware/intel/common/omx-components/videocodec/libvpx_internal/libvpx/vp8/common/arm/neon/ |
bilinearpredict_neon.c | 34 uint8x16_t q1u8, q2u8; local 61 q1u8 = vcombine_u8(d2u8, d3u8); 67 q4u64 = vshrq_n_u64(vreinterpretq_u64_u8(q1u8), 8); 71 d0u32x2 = vzip_u32(vreinterpret_u32_u8(vget_low_u8(q1u8)), 72 vreinterpret_u32_u8(vget_high_u8(q1u8))); 138 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8; local 149 q1u8 = vld1q_u8(src_ptr); src_ptr += src_pixels_per_line; 158 q6u16 = vmull_u8(vget_low_u8(q1u8), d0u8); 164 d3u8 = vext_u8(vget_low_u8(q1u8), vget_high_u8(q1u8), 1) 225 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8; local 366 uint8x16_t q1u8, q2u8, q3u8, q4u8, q5u8, q6u8, q7u8, q8u8, q9u8, q10u8; local [all...] |